Kakumau
Tandiyawan block · Hardoi
district, Uttar Pradesh · PIN 241304
· village code 140193
Population 2011
2,398
Census of India
Population 2020
3,116
Mission Antyodaya survey
Change
+29.9%
718 people · 3.0% a year
Households
454
+13.8% vs 399 in 2011
Census 2011
Total population
2,398
Male / female
1,256 / 1,142
Sex ratio females per 1,000 males
909
Children aged 0–6
438
Literacy rate
46.3%
Scheduled Caste / Scheduled Tribe
1,527 / 0
Working population
829
Of workers, in agriculture cultivators and farm labour
78.0%
Households
399

Gram panchayat finances, 2024–25
XV Finance Commission grant for
Kakumau panchayat, Tandiyawan zila parishad.
These are the panchayat's own accounts, not this village's: where a panchayat
holds several villages, the money covers all of them, and where a village
spans several panchayats only this one's return appears.
Opening balance
₹3.06 lakh
Received from state (auto-transfer)
₹9.81 lakh
Received directly
₹2.13 lakh
Spent
₹14.79 lakh
Unspent at year end
₹20,060
Untied (basic grant)
opened ₹1.76 lakh · received ₹3.92 lakh · spent ₹5.56 lakh · left ₹15,541
Tied (earmarked)
opened ₹1.29 lakh · received ₹5.88 lakh · spent ₹9.23 lakh · left ₹4,519
Source: eGramSwaraj, as reported by the panchayat. Untied and tied
together make up the totals above.
